Roscoe Village offers the perfect blend of small-town charm and urban convenience in the heart of Chicago’s North Side. This charming neighborhood features tree-lined streets, independent boutiques, and a thriving restaurant scene centered around the Roscoe Street corridor. With easy access to the Brown Line, proximity to Wrigley Field, and a tight-knit community atmosphere, Roscoe Village attracts residents seeking a welcoming neighborhood with excellent walkability and local character.
Roscoe Village features a diverse housing mix including vintage three-flat walk-ups, charming brick courtyard buildings, modern condos, and newly constructed luxury developments.
The dining and entertainment scene in Roscoe Village centers around authentic local experiences and neighborhood gathering spots. Start your morning at Beans & Bagels, a beloved coffee shop and breakfast spot, then explore unique finds at The Lazy Dog Antique Store, a neighborhood treasure trove. For dinner, enjoy classic martinis and live music at the iconic Savannah Supper Club, grab craft cocktails at the intimate Bluelight lounge, or catch live music at Beat Kitchen, a cornerstone venue for local and touring bands. Four Treys Tavern serves as the neighborhood’s go-to sports bar, while the annual Roscoe Village Burger Fest brings the community together each summer to celebrate local restaurants and neighborhood pride.
Roscoe Village’s housing stock showcases classic Chicago architecture with a residential feel that’s increasingly rare on the North Side. The neighborhood features beautifully maintained vintage brick walk-ups with original hardwood floors, decorative moldings, and sun-drenched bay windows. Tree-lined streets are home to classic two-flats and single-family homes with wrap-around porches and private yards, while newer construction condos offer modern finishes, in-unit laundry, and rooftop decks. Many buildings feature exposed brick, updated kitchens with stainless appliances, and renovated bathrooms that blend historic charm with contemporary convenience, making Roscoe Village ideal for renters seeking character without sacrificing modern amenities.

Average rent in Roscoe Village starts at approximately $1,350 for a studio to $2,400 for a 2-bedroom apartment. Prices vary depending on the building, amenities, and exact location within the neighborhood.

Roscoe Village is well-served by public transit. Key CTA stops include Brown Line Paulina and Brown Line Addison. These provide convenient access to downtown Chicago and surrounding neighborhoods.
Neighborhoods near Roscoe Village include Lakeview, Lincoln Square, Logan Square and Wicker Park. Each of these neighborhoods has its own unique character and amenities, giving residents plenty of options for dining, shopping, and entertainment.
